Size sponsors SABA

The South Australian Band Association (SABA) is pleased to announce that Size Music will be the major sponsor for the 2008 SABA State Band Championships.

Size Music has been a consistent supporter and partner to many community-based music events held in and around Adelaide, including the Barossa Band Festival in 2006 and Orchestra’s Australia’s Big Play in 2007.

This new sponsorship agreement will provide funds in support of the staging of the State Championships at Elder Hall — a wonderful professional venue – and paying costs associated with adjudicators.

In addition, Size Music will donate a perpetual shield and a $250.00 Size Music voucher to be awarded as the Band Aggregate Prize at the SABA Solo Championships in June.

Size Music is proud to be able to support the Concert and Brass Band community in South Australia, said Managing Director Andrew Size.

"On behalf of all members of the South Australian Band Association, I would like to thank Size Music for supporting our key banding events with such a generous contribution. I look forward to a long and mutually beneficial association between Size Music and banding in this State," said SABA President Kevin Cameron.

The SABA Solo Championships will be held at Pembroke School in 14-15 June.

The SABA State Band Championships will be held at Elder Hall, University of Adelaide, on Saturday 16 August.
